Chilean Television Ratings During Coverage
According to data shared with The Fourth,Mega led the online television ratings during the extensive coverage of Maduro’s arrest. The channel substantially outperformed its competitors.
Mega opted to postpone the premiere of the new season of ”Only Friends” to prioritize continuous news coverage of the unfolding events. The episode is now scheduled to air on Saturday, January 10.
Between 6:00 AM and midnight, Mega averaged 536,918 viewers per minute, securing the top position in ratings for the day.
Chilevision followed in second place, with an average of 337,031 viewers per minute during the same period.Canal 13 came in third, averaging 265,288 viewers, while TVN trailed with an average of 187,562 viewers per minute.
